aboutsummaryrefslogtreecommitdiffstats
path: root/tools/perf/scripts/python/export-to-postgresql.py
diff options
context:
space:
mode:
authorEmil Tsalapatis <etsal@meta.com>2025-10-16 11:11:26 -0700
committerTejun Heo <tj@kernel.org>2025-10-16 08:34:00 -1000
commita3c4a0a42e61aad1056a3d33fd603c1ae66d4288 (patch)
treecd6e6bbed46c0cc1dfa35829b6e1dec32ca3c5ba /tools/perf/scripts/python/export-to-postgresql.py
parentsched_ext: Fix scx_kick_pseqs corruption on concurrent scheduler loads (diff)
downloadlinux-rng-a3c4a0a42e61aad1056a3d33fd603c1ae66d4288.tar.xz
linux-rng-a3c4a0a42e61aad1056a3d33fd603c1ae66d4288.zip
sched_ext: fix flag check for deferred callbacks
When scheduling the deferred balance callbacks, check SCX_RQ_BAL_CB_PENDING instead of SCX_RQ_BAL_PENDING. This way schedule_deferred() properly tests whether there is already a pending request for queue_balance_callback() to be invoked at the end of .balance(). Fixes: a8ad873113d3 ("sched_ext: defer queue_balance_callback() until after ops.dispatch") Signed-off-by: Emil Tsalapatis <emil@etsalapatis.com> Signed-off-by: Tejun Heo <tj@kernel.org>
Diffstat (limited to 'tools/perf/scripts/python/export-to-postgresql.py')
0 files changed, 0 insertions, 0 deletions